A bill to am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to treat certain farming business machinery and equipment as 5-year property for purposes of depreciation.

Introduced: October 7, 2005 See on congress.gov

 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Amends the Internal Revenue Code to allow a five-year depreciation recovery period for certain farming business machinery or equipment placed in service before January 1, 2010.
